A funnel cloud touching the ground is what?

A funnel cloud touching the ground is a tornado. This occurs when the rotation of a funnel cloud extends to the surface, resulting in destructive winds and potentially dangerous conditions. Tornadoes are characterized by their funnel-shaped cloud and intense swirling winds.
